Kirjoittaja Aihe: Osioiden liitokset sekaisin/swap ei käytössä[RATKAISTU]  (Luettu 2210 kertaa)

koomikko

  • Käyttäjä
  • Viestejä: 103
    • Profiili
Alkutilanne:
sda1 Gutsyn juuri
sda2 swap
sda3 media
sda4 Gutsyn home

Asensin sda3:lle Debianin, CD:ltä, eli juuri ja home samalle osiolle. Annoin tehdä myös uuden grubin. Debian tuntuu toimivan hienosti, mutta asennus sekoitti jotain Gutsyn asennuksesta.
 
Kun käynnistän Ubuntulle, niin kesken käynnistyksen heittää kuvassa olevan herjaruudun.
Control+d, käynnistys jatkuu normaalisti. Tuntuisi molemmat järjestelmät toimivan, vaikka joku on vielä pielessä.

fsck:
Log of fsck -C -R -A -a
Sat Oct 27 16:06:47 2007
fsck 1.40.2 (12-Jul-2007)
/dev/sda4: clean, 5885/15351808 files, 2909068/30682141 blocks (check in 2 mounts)
fsck.ext3: Unable to resolve 'UUID=6d9d03a6-bbc8-4779-9530-312866bde13e'
fsck died with exit status 8
Sat Oct 27 16:06:48 2007

Laitehallinnassa sda4, volume.uuid sting 59f1ad9e-518f-4a37-8472-a1b6676c8f91

Onko vika liitoksissa/uuid:ssä? En edes varmaksi tiedä mikä toi uuid on. Mikä mättää, milläköhän homman sais kuntoon?

[ylläpito on poistanut liitteen]
« Viimeksi muokattu: 27.10.07 - klo:21.28 kirjoittanut koomikko »

ighea

  • Käyttäjä
  • Viestejä: 158
  • Linux Power since 2001
    • Profiili
    • blogi&ks
Vs: Osioiden liitokset/tiedostojärjestelmä sekaisin?
« Vastaus #1 : 27.10.07 - klo:18.27 »
Vika ilmenee siinä, että asentaessasi debianin olet ilmeisesti alustanut/kirjoittanut uuden tiedostojärjestelmän sda3-levyosiollesi, jonka seurauksena aseman UUID(Universally Unique Identifier eli pikasuomennuksella yksilöllinen tunniste) on mennyt uuteen uskoon. En nyt kirveelläkään muista/saanut kaivettua, lelua jolal niitä voi esiin poimia, mutta koska tiedät missä kohtaa ongelma tarkalleen on, niin voit etsiä ubuntun /etc/fstab:sta rivin joka mounttaa /media:si ja korvata siellä tuon UUID=6d9d03a6-bbc8-4779-9530-312866bde13e rimpsun ihan vain /dev/sda3:lla. Jolloin kaikki pitäisi taas mennä kuten pitää, olettaen toki, että tahdot edelleen liittää "/media"-osiosi, jossa nyt debian majailee juuri tuonne.
Real Unix/Linux men, do not use Emacs, neither vi, neither ed
They use cat, and get it right the first time

Pikaruokaa.fi - Vatsantäytettä vaikka kotiovelle kuljetettuna

juyli

  • Vieras
Vs: Osioiden liitokset/tiedostojärjestelmä sekaisin?
« Vastaus #2 : 27.10.07 - klo:18.32 »
Asensin sda3:lle Debianin, CD:ltä, eli juuri ja home samalle osiolle. Annoin tehdä myös uuden grubin. Debian tuntuu toimivan hienosti, mutta asennus sekoitti jotain Gutsyn asennuksesta.
Todennäköisesti asentaessasi Debianin (ja tehdessäsi sille tiedostojärjestelmän) on UUID vaihtunut, joten Ubuntu ei sitä pysty vanhan UUID:n perusteella liittämään.
Voisit aluksi poistaa käytöstä koko rivin, jolla Debian-osio liitetään järjestelmään (/dev/sda3) /etc/fstab tiedostossa.
Jos haluat liittää Debian-osion Ubuntu-jakeluun lisää se sopivasti Ubuntun /etc/fstab tiedostoon.
Olisi valaisevaa nähdä Ubuntun /etc/fstab tarkimpia arvailuja varten.
Kannattaa myös miettiä, kumman järjestelmän grub:ia käytät Ubuntun vai Debianin, ja käyttää sitten sitä.

koomikko

  • Käyttäjä
  • Viestejä: 103
    • Profiili
Vs: Osioiden liitokset/tiedostojärjestelmä sekaisin?
« Vastaus #3 : 27.10.07 - klo:20.06 »
Poistin sda3/Debia osion fstab listasta.
Kone käynnistyi normaalisti.

Aivan oikein arvattu swap ei ole käytössä

mikko@mikko-desktop:~$ free -m
             total       used       free     shared    buffers     cached
Mem:           947        413        534          0          9        254
-/+ buffers/cache:        148        798
Swap:            0          0          0
mikko@mikko-desktop:~$ sudo vol_id /dev/sda2 | grep UUID
[sudo] password for mikko:
ID_FS_UUID=
ID_FS_UUID_ENC=

Milläköhän komennolla sen saa liitettyä?
Mitä toi fstab:n error sda1:lle tarkoittaa?

# /etc/fstab: static file system information.
#
# <file system> <mount point>   <type>  <options>       <dump>  <pass>
proc            /proc           proc    defaults        0       0
# /dev/sda1
UUID=b86e7f61-ad71-4bf7-aa0c-e85a9ba0c350 /               ext3    defaults,errors=remount-ro 0       1
# /dev/sda4
UUID=59f1ad9e-518f-4a37-8472-a1b6676c8f91 /home           ext3    defaults        0       2
# /dev/sda2
UUID=aa07f74b-67ee-419d-9790-a42ad119475c none            swap    sw              0       0
/dev/hda        /media/cdrom0   udf,iso9660 user,noauto,exec 0       0
/dev/fd0        /media/floppy0  auto    rw,user,noauto,exec 0       0

Onko väliä mikä Grub on käytössä, vaikuttaako esim.nopeuteen? Tällä hetkellä Debianin sda3:lla sijaitseva.

koomikko

  • Käyttäjä
  • Viestejä: 103
    • Profiili
Vs: Osioiden liitokset/tiedostojärjestelmä sekaisin?
« Vastaus #4 : 27.10.07 - klo:21.26 »
Kiitokset avusta, nyt toimii, niin kuin pitääkin.

Eli poistin fstabista /media levyn sda3 liitoksen
Muutin swap-rivin ohjeen mukaisesti
Swapin liittäminen sudo mount -a
Uudelleen käynnistys

En halunnut Debian osiota näkymään Ubuntussa, joten en lisännyt sitä fstabiin.